Arundel has a fascinating history that dates back centuries. The town was originally established in the late 19th century and named after Lord Arundel, a prominent British nobleman. Over the years, Arundel has evolved from a timber and mining hub into the vibrant and picturesque destination it is today.
Nature enthusiasts will find themselves enthralled by the breathtaking landscapes that surround Arundel. The town is blessed with an abundance of natural wonders, including lush forests, sprawling lakes, and cascading rivers. This pristine environment offers endless opportunities for outdoor activities such as hiking, biking, fishing, and boating. Arundel is also within close proximity to the renowned Mont-Tremblant National Park, further enhancing the outdoor experiences available to residents and visitors.
